The Black Bear Population in North Carolina


Before delving into the hunting seasons, it's essential to understand the black bear population in North Carolina. The state is home to one of the largest black bear populations on the East Coast, with an estimated 20,000 to 25,000 black bears residing in its mountain and coastal regions. This robust population provides ample hunting opportunities for enthusiasts looking to pursue these majestic creatures.


Black Bear Hunting Seasons


North Carolina offers various hunting seasons for black bears, catering to different hunting preferences and styles. The hunting seasons typically include:


Archery Season: Archery enthusiasts can kick off the hunting season in early September, taking advantage of the bear's natural foraging patterns as they search for food in preparation for winter. This season provides a challenging and stealthy hunting experience.


Black Powder Season: Black powder hunters can join the fray shortly after the archery season, usually in mid-September, using muzzleloaders to harvest black bears. This season allows for a more traditional hunting experience, combining skill and precision.


General Firearms Season: The most popular hunting season for black bears in North Carolina is the general firearms season, which typically runs from mid-November to early January. This period offers hunters the chance to use modern firearms and is often associated with a higher success rate.


Dog Hunting Season: For those who prefer the traditional method of using dogs to track and tree bears, North Carolina offers a dedicated season for bear hunting with dogs, starting in early December and lasting into February.
